Temperature in AI. What It Means and How It Works

Temperature

Temperature is a setting that controls how creative or random an AI’s answers are. Low temperature makes responses safe and predictable; high temperature makes them more varied and surprising.

Definition

Temperature is a setting that makes AI outputs more predictable or more creative.

Detailed Explanation

What it is: Temperature is a simple control in many AI tools that adjusts how adventurous the AI should be when choosing words or ideas.

How it works: Think of temperature like a dial: set it low and the AI picks the most likely, safe responses; set it higher and it explores less-likely, more surprising options. You usually change a number (often between 0 and 1) to shift behavior.

Why it matters: It helps you get the kind of output you need β€” consistent facts or fresh creative ideas β€” so you can tune results for writing, brainstorming, or reliable answers.

Real-World Examples

  • OpenAI Playground/ChatGPT: a slider or parameter lets you pick low vs. high creativity for chat replies.
  • Story writing tools: higher temperature is used to generate unexpected plot twists or character ideas.
  • Marketing copy generators: lower temperature creates consistent, brand-safe messaging.
  • Brainstorming apps: higher temperature produces many different concepts to choose from.

Use Cases

✍️ Creative Writing

Use a higher temperature to get surprising lines, unusual metaphors, or new character ideas when writing stories or poems.

πŸ’‘ Brainstorming

Turn up the temperature to generate lots of different ideas for product names, taglines, or features.

πŸ“§ Email & Customer Messages

Keep temperature low to ensure clear, professional, and consistent responses for support or business emails.

πŸ“Š Reports & Summaries

Use a low temperature to get concise, accurate summaries or factual reports with less risk of errors.

🎨 Prompt Crafting for Images

Higher temperature can help you discover unusual prompt variations to create unexpected visuals in image-generation tools.

PROS & CONS

βœ… Pros

  • Gives you control over creativity vs. predictability.
  • Easy to change β€” one number can shift output style.
  • Helps match AI output to the task (factual vs. creative).

❌Cons

  • High temperature can produce strange or incorrect answers.
  • Low temperature can feel repetitive or dull.
  • Best setting often requires trial and error.

Common Mistakes

Thinking higher is always better

Many beginners assume more creativity is always desirable, but high temperature can cause incorrect or irrelevant results.

Confusing temperature with tone

Temperature controls randomness and variety, not the emotional tone (like formal vs. friendly), which is set by the prompt.

Expecting the same numbers across tools

Different tools and models use different scales and defaults, so a “0.8” in one place may behave differently in another.
